University of New England

UNE is a private research university in Maine with campuses in Portland and Biddeford, as well as a study abroad campus in Tangier, Morocco. UNE is Maine's largest private university and the state's largest educator of healthcare professionals.

University of New England History

The history of the University of New England is rich and varied, reflecting the determination, creativity, and resourcefulness of its founders as well as the history of Maine and New England. It's a wonderful story that begins in 1939 with Franciscan monks on the banks of the Saco River establishing the College Seraphique, a high school and junior college for boys of Quebecois descent. St. Francis College was established in 1952 as a four-year liberal arts college. In the late 1970s, as the college struggled financially, necessity and opportunity met in the form of the New England College of Osteopathic Medicine. The College of Osteopathic Medicine was established on the St. Francis campus, and the two institutions merged to form the University of New England in 1978.

University of New England Programs, Courses, and Schools

The University of New England is Maine's largest private university and the state's largest educator of healthcare professionals. It is divided into five colleges, which together offer over 70 undergraduate, graduate, online, and professional degrees. University of New England is best known for its program in the sciences and health sciences, but it also offers degrees in the marine sciences, data science, environmental science, mathematics, business, education, the humanities, and a variety of other fields. Its College of Osteopathic Medicine is Maine's only medical school, and its College of Dental Medicine is northern New England's only dental college.

University of New England Infrastructure & Services

Campus

The University of New England has three campuses that offer students a variety of learning environments. The university's two campuses in coastal Maine, USA, house undergraduate, graduate, and professional program, while the Tangier Campus in Morocco offers a semester-abroad opportunity. The Biddeford Campus is 540 acres (220 ha) in size, with 0.75 mile (1.21 km) of ocean frontage where the Saco River meets the Atlantic Ocean. The Harold Alfond Center for Health Sciences, the Pickus Center for Biomedical Research, and the Marine Science Center are among the campus's 26 buildings. Portland Campus is a national historic district covering 41 acres (17 ha). It is in a suburban neighborhood, just a short drive from downtown Portland. The Westbrook College of Health Professions and the College of Dental Medicine are located on the UNE Portland Campus. The first class of the College of Dental Medicine, which is housed in the $14.5 million Oral Health Center, graduated in 2017. It is the state's only dental college.

Library

The Library Services at the University of New England are essential to the intellectual life of the university community. They foster a vibrant learning environment by providing access to scholarly collections and resources; providing services that encourage inquiry and independent, lifelong learning; providing welcoming, interactive spaces and infrastructure that enhance the educational experience and support the university's information needs; and preserving specific special collections. Larger special collections are also housed at UNE Libraries, including the Maine Women Writers Collection, the New England Osteopathic Heritage Center, the Sandra and Bernard Featherman University Archives, and the UNE Art Galleries.

Visas & immigration support

The University of New England assists students with visa and immigration matters. The Designated School Official (DSO) from the Global Education Program contacts international students once they have been accepted to UNE and have paid the initial deposit. The DSO will issue a Certificate of Eligibility for Nonimmigrant Student Status, also known as Form I-20, after receiving and reviewing the requested information and documentation. Country-specific instructions for applying for the F-1 student visa from a US Embassy or Consulate abroad will be included with Form I-20.

Sports and Fitness

Finley Recreation Center provides sports and fitness facilities to the University of New England. The Beverly Burpee Finley Recreation Center has a gymnasium, a fitness center, a group exercise room, and full locker rooms. The facilities host a variety of recreational, wellness, and fitness program, as well as intramural sports. The fitness center has cardio equipment as well as a strength and conditioning area. Personal training sessions, fitness assessments, equipment orientations, fitness training programs, nutrition and stress management programs are examples of professional services.

Health and Well-being 

Students counseling center provides health and well-being services at the University of New England. Individual evidence-based, solution-focused short-term counseling and services are provided by the Center for on-campus undergraduate and graduate students enrolled in degree-granting program. Ethnicity, spirituality, culture, sexual orientation, gender, disability, learning differences, and body image are all issues that its counsellors are sensitive to. Counseling sessions are private and do not appear on your academic record.

 Part time jobs

Students at the University of New England can work part-time while attending classes. Many work-study positions are posted by campus offices on Handshake, the Career Center's online job posting site. To apply for open positions, you must upload an updated, college-level resume to your Handshake profile; once reviewed, you will receive either constructive feedback or an approval notice. Some international students may require extra work authorization as well as a social security number.
